In the midst of having some fun with using TNT to push entities, I have found that some entities that are shot upwards past the build height do not return as that entity but instead as dropped block of the related block.
I have tested this with Falling Sand, Falling Gravel, Falling Anvils and Shot Arrows and all return as their respective dropped items after they travel beyond the build height, which was set to 256. This is not affected by the players Game Mode.
There is an attached map file with a proof of concept to demonstrate this. If you fill all the dispensers with TNT and place sand in the marked location, you will see the sand travel up as a block and return as an entity.
